Castle Celebrations

Begin the New Year feeling like royalty at these hotels with history, from celebrating Hogmanay in the Scottish Highlands to tasting kransekage in a Danish castle.

Inverlochy Castle, Scotland…The Scots certainly know how to celebrate the last day of the year, and what better setting than a 19th-century castle with Ben Nevis and a private loch as a backdrop. Hogmanay celebrations at Inverlochy Castle begin with a morning of clay pigeon shooting, followed by mince pies, mulled wine, afternoon tea, and a champagne reception. Dance the night away to the traditional tunes of the Picts Ceilidh Band, before a Highland Piper serenades the start of the new year at midnight – accompanied by bacon rolls, of course.

Crossbasket Castle, Scotland…Step into a world of smooth whisky and soaring turrets at this clotted-cream coloured castle overlooking the waterfalls of River Calder. Explore the tranquil grounds of this vast estate by day, before tucking in to a festive feast prepared by the Roux family in the original rooms of the castle.

Schlosshotel Kronberg, Germany…Originally built in 1893 as the home to Empress Victoria Friedrich, the eldest daughter of Queen Victoria, this history-laden castle makes a grand first impression. Gather round the fireplace in the Great Hall to toast the New Year, or spend the evening in the hotel’s rustic Alpine cabin enjoying late-night Bavarian snacks and Swiss raclette.

Domaine des Etangs, France…With its elegant turrets, sweeping grounds and magical setting between forest and lake, this château in the Charente countryside is fit for royalty. Make your first and last meals of the year moments to remember at the Michelin-starred Dyades restaurant, where the menu changes daily based on the seasonal ingredients locally available.

Kokkedal Castle Copenhagen, Denmark…Leap into the New Year (according to Danish tradition, this symbolises overcoming challenges in the year to come) from this 18th-century castle on the Danish Riviera, just half an hour from Copenhagen‘s legendary firework display. Sit down to a festive lunch, or Julefrokoster, beside crackling log fires on selected Fridays and Saturdays in December.
